Expansion of the modular drive system
When selecting a drive, users have a wide range of requirements, for example in terms of drive power, gearbox designs, reduction stages, control or connection technology. In order to be able to cover even higher outputs in automation, ebm-papst has expanded its existing ECI drive series to include size 80 and will be presenting it at Logimat.
